Transaction 21b49ad31e40e812912a147fe9e04a32ddb4e5c279ee6807c08aab6d49c415dd
1 Input
1 Output
-
21b49ad31e40e812912a147fe9e04a32ddb4e5c279ee6807c08aab6d49c415dd:0
- value
- 154256060
- script pubkey
- OP_0 OP_PUSHBYTES_20 82e7d2b84565de260c304bfe8b89b8dc35c08d89
- address
- bc1qstna9wz9vh0zvrpsf0lghzdcms6uprvfh2p77v